Every single-shot CEP drift detection for near-infrared lasers with modified TOUCAN method

Not Accessible

Your library or personal account may give you access

Abstract

The original TOUCAN device is capable of single-shot CEP drift measurement of ~3 µm lasers at arbitrary repetition rate. We have expanded this technique for near-infrared lasers and crosschecked results with a traditional measurement method.
